summ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Jeroen van Meeuwen (Kolab Systems) <vanmeeuwen@kolabsys.com>2014-02-15 11:59:02 (GMT)
committerJeroen van Meeuwen (Kolab Systems) <vanmeeuwen@kolabsys.com>2014-02-15 11:59:02 (GMT)
commit04350db8acc6e0075d9b21090b1339dde7b4b7b1 (patch)
tree308d22347039c0adb5e133323a07dcde431a87f2
parent6336c54e7ede8b3de98755814448e3cb9bc00e7b (diff)
downloadkolab-scripts-04350db8acc6e0075d9b21090b1339dde7b4b7b1.tar.gz
Update wheezy to 3.2
-rw-r--r--autoinstall/bootstrap/bootstrap-wheezy-script.txt8
-rw-r--r--autoinstall/wheezy-32.cfg45
2 files changed, 49 insertions, 4 deletions
diff --git a/autoinstall/bootstrap/bootstrap-wheezy-script.txt b/autoinstall/bootstrap/bootstrap-wheezy-script.txt
index b0e8804..389bcf1 100644
--- a/autoinstall/bootstrap/bootstrap-wheezy-script.txt
+++ b/autoinstall/bootstrap/bootstrap-wheezy-script.txt
@@ -2,14 +2,14 @@
# Add the kolab repository.
cat > /etc/apt/sources.list.d/kolab.list << EOF
-deb http://obs.kolabsys.com:82/Kolab:/3.1/Debian_7.0/ ./
-deb http://obs.kolabsys.com:82/Kolab:/3.1:/Updates/Debian_7.0/ ./
+deb http://obs.kolabsys.com:82/Kolab:/3.2/Debian_7.0/ ./
+deb http://obs.kolabsys.com:82/Kolab:/3.2:/Updates/Debian_7.0/ ./
EOF
-wget http://obs.kolabsys.com:82/Kolab:/3.1/Debian_7.0/Release.key
+wget http://obs.kolabsys.com:82/Kolab:/3.2/Debian_7.0/Release.key
apt-key add Release.key
rm -rf Release.key
-wget http://obs.kolabsys.com:82/Kolab:/3.1:/Updates/Debian_7.0/Release.key
+wget http://obs.kolabsys.com:82/Kolab:/3.2:/Updates/Debian_7.0/Release.key
apt-key add Release.key
rm -rf Release.key
diff --git a/autoinstall/wheezy-32.cfg b/autoinstall/wheezy-32.cfg
new file mode 100644
index 0000000..ab6c7b8
--- /dev/null
+++ b/autoinstall/wheezy-32.cfg
@@ -0,0 +1,45 @@
+d-i debian-installer/locale string en_US
+d-i console-keymaps-at/keymap select us
+d-i netcfg/choose_interface select auto
+d-i netcfg/get_hostname kolab.example.org
+d-i netcfg/get_domain kolab.example.org
+d-i netcfg/wireless_wep string
+d-i mirror/country string enter information manually
+d-i mirror/http/hostname string ftp.debian.org
+d-i mirror/http/directory string /debian/
+d-i clock-setup/utc boolean true
+d-i time/zone string Europe/Zurich
+d-i clock-setup/ntp boolean true
+
+d-i partman-auto/disk string /dev/sda
+d-i partman-auto/method string lvm
+d-i partman-auto/choose_recipe select atomic
+d-i partman-lvm/confirm boolean true
+d-i partman-lvm/device_remove_lvm boolean true
+d-i partman-lvm/confirm_nooverwrite boolean true
+d-i partman/choose_partition select finish
+d-i partman/confirm boolean true
+d-i partman/confirm_nooverwrite boolean true
+d-i partman-basicfilesystems/no_mount_point yes
+
+d-i passwd/root-password password Welcome2KolabSystems
+d-i passwd/root-password-again password Welcome2KolabSystems
+
+d-i passwd/user-fullname string Kolab Systems User
+d-i passwd/username string developer
+d-i passwd/user-password password Welcome2KolabSystems
+d-i passwd/user-password-again password Welcome2KolabSystems
+
+d-i apt-setup/non-free boolean true
+d-i apt-setup/contrib boolean true
+
+tasksel tasksel/first multiselect standard
+d-i pkgsel/include select openssh-server sysv-rc-conf wget
+d-i popularity-contest/participate boolean false
+
+d-i grub-installer/only_debian boolean true
+d-i grub-installer/with_other_os boolean true
+
+d-i preseed/late_command string in-target wget -q -O/root/init.sh http://git.kolab.org/kolab-scripts/plain/autoinstall/bootstrap/bootstrap-wheezy-script.txt; in-target chmod +x /root/init.sh; in-target bash /root/init.sh
+
+d-i finish-install/reboot_in_progress note